About This Service

About this Service

Solar Panel Maintenance in Point Loma focuses on coastal residential rooftop arrays and peninsula properties where salt spray and ocean-driven dust speed soiling. It suits single-family homes and peninsula residences that need regular washing to protect glass and maintain production under marine exposure.

Work for this area typically starts with a pre-clean condition and access check, followed by soft brushing and an optional deionized water rinse to remove salt residues without mineral streaking. Technicians note racking condition and edge seals during the visit because coastal corrosion can appear beneath debris.

Expected outcome is clearer glass and reduced soiling-related output loss after each wash; sustained benefit depends on scheduling frequency since salt and pollen re-deposit rapidly on exposed peninsulas.
